Transaction 580b46384118250a2470cf42da84015f276b7b33b725efa4f5f38de7d565a96e
1 Input
2 Outputs
- 580b46384118250a2470cf42da84015f276b7b33b725efa4f5f38de7d565a96e:0
- 580b46384118250a2470cf42da84015f276b7b33b725efa4f5f38de7d565a96e:1
value 2294999
address 39aT3J3iCB9LvBZAAmAuLcyprUJyBY5Cxm
value 1241010612
address 1CutnC3uET6RbSZKVAfs6N8AumorgXKEnV